Molecular characterization and evolution of a gene family encoding male-specific reproductive proteins in the African malaria vector <it>Anopheles gambiae</it>
<p>Abstract</p> <p>Background</p> <p>During copulation, the major Afro-tropical malaria vector <it>Anopheles gambiae </it>s.s. transfers male accessory gland (MAG) proteins to females as a solid mass (i.e. the "mating plug"). These proteins are pos...
